http://www.icd9data.com/2012/Volume1/390-459/410-414/413/413.9.htm WebB. I25.720. C. I25.709. D. I25.700. correct answer: D. ICD-10-CM provides a combination code for this diagnosis. The correct code assignment for CAD of bypass graft with unstable angina is I25.700, located in the alphabetic index under Arteriosclerosis, coronary (artery), bypass graft, with, angina pectoris, unstable.

This division (classification) was developed by Brownwald in the late 80's. WebICD-10-CM has combination codes for atherosclerotic heart disease with angina pectoris. The subcategories for these codes are I25.11, Atherosclerotic heart disease of native coronary artery with angina pectoris and I25.7, Atherosclerosis of coronary artery bypass graft (s) and coronary artery of transplanted heart with angina pectoris.
